How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Prescott Mill Courts?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Prescott Mill Courts Studio Apartments | $1,690 | $1,310 | $1,905 |
Prescott Mill Courts 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,985 | $1,100 | $2,890 |
Prescott Mill Courts 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,221 | $1,200 | $3,174 |
Prescott Mill Courts 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,024 | $1,653 | $3,864 |
Prescott Mill Courts 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,338 | $3,137 | $3,522 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Prescott Mill Courts
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Prescott Mill Courts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Prescott Mill Courts ranges from $1,100 to $2,890 with an average monthly rent of $1,985.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Prescott Mill Courts c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Prescott Mill Courts range from $1,200 to $3,174.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,221.
How expensive are Prescott Mill Courts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 9 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Prescott Mill Courts on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,653 to $3,864 - averaging $3,024 for the location.
